Design of 8-QAM+ perfect arrays from perfect ternary arrays

摘要

In communications, radar, sonar, and so forth, perfect arrays play fairly important roles. In this paper, we will investigate the construction methods of such arrays over the 8-QAM+ constellation. More clearly, for a given existing perfect ternary array (PTA), we will present two methods to convert it into an 8-QAM+ perfect array, depending on the existence of odd number in its size or not, respectively. If all numbers in the size of the PTA to be transformed are even, the size of the resultant arrays is the same original one. Otherwise, it is expanded. Finally, the examples, given by us, show the validity of our methods.
